HCS SB 981 -- STATE HIGHWAY PATROL SPONSOR: Goodman (Behnen) COMMITTEE ACTION: Voted "do pass by consent" by the Committee on Crime Prevention and Public Safety by a vote of 10 to 0. This substitute allows the Superintendent of the State Highway Patrol to establish guidelines under which members of the patrol may be employed in another position. FISCAL NOTE: No impact on state funds in FY 2007, FY 2008, and FY 2009. PROPONENTS: Supporters say that the bill will give highway patrolmen other options to earn additional money for their families. Testifying for the bill were Senator Goodman; and Missouri State Troopers Association. OPPONENTS: There was no opposition voiced to the committee.
